Nothing. It's ability to buy online, but that is in the theater's best interest as it saves them money from not having to staff multiple ticketing people as well as paper waste from physical tickets. It's just a made up fee to charge you more. It's why I only go to the Cinemark near the house. $11 a month membership in their club gets 1 ticket a month "free", waives those rip off fees, and you get 25 percent off concessions. The free tickets roll over as well. There hasn't been any movies since Twisters in the summer the family wanted to see so those tickets were rolling over for a few months for me. Wife and daughters wanted to go see "Wicked" so I used my credits to take them to the movies for $13. I think our concessions came out to about $24 after the discount, so $37 total on what would have cost $100. Highly recommend it for people with kids who go to the movies several times a year.
